Does this design reflect a(n)...
• well developed and easily understood concept?
Your conceptual solution clearly communicates the massage that you intend to convey.
Please make sure that the image that you have used is in fact a landmine. From my past experience (I spent 1 ½ years in the military), the image that you used looks like it is either a grenade or a mortar shell rather than a landmine. The shapes of the different devices differ radically. Grenades can be set up as landmines but it is less common.
Also look at your use of language in the headline. ‘Peek-a-boo’ is a common vernacular phrase in North American but is not necessarily universal. For instance, in my region we use the term ‘hide and seek’ and ‘boo!’.
• level of social engagement?
Good. See above comments to make it even more powerful.
• understanding of the issues reflected in the poster?
Good.
• sense of internationalism and accessibility?
Good. You might want to consider a series of posters that look the same but changing the headline to contextualise it to regional vernacular language.